Pool Care Challenges Unique to Tomball

Every area in North Houston is different. In The Woodlands, you fight the trees. Here in Tomball, we fight the exposure.

The Chlorine Burn-Off: Because many yards here have less shade, the sun hits the water hard. UV rays destroy chlorine. If your stabilizer (cyanuric acid) levels aren't perfectly balanced, the sun will burn off your sanitizer in a matter of hours. We see this all the time. A homeowner adds shock. They think they are good for a week. But the sun eats it up by the next day. The water is left unprotected, and the algae takes hold immediately.

​

Dust and Construction Debris: Tomball is growing. There is construction everywhere. The wind carries fine dust and dirt into your pool. This doesn't just make the floor look dirty; it clogs your filter. When a filter is clogged with fine dust, the pressure rises. The water flow slows down. Your circulation system becomes weak. Without strong circulation, chemicals don't mix, and dead spots form in the deep end. That is where algae starts.

​

Lawn Runoff and Phosphates: We have a lot of grass here. When you or your lawn crew mows, clippings get in the water. When it rains, fertilizer runoff from the yard washes into the pool. Fertilizer is designed to make plants grow. Algae is a plant. When nitrates and phosphates from the lawn get into your pool, you are essentially fertilizing the algae. It creates a "phosphate lock" where even high levels of chlorine can't keep the water clear. You have to treat the phosphates to starve the algae.

​

Aging Equipment vs. New Technology: Tomball has a mix of older pools with 15-year-old single-speed pumps and brand new pools with high-tech variable-speed drives. The old pumps use a ton of energy and often leak. The new pumps are great, but half the time the builders program them wrong. They run them too slow to skim the water effectively. We know how to handle both. We keep the old iron running, and we reprogram the new tech to actually work.

Pool Maintenance in Tomball, TX

Cleaning is about the water. Maintenance is about the machine.
 

Your pool relies on a complex system of plumbing, electrical, and mechanical parts. The heat in Tomball is hard on equipment. Rubber seals dry out. Plastic becomes brittle. Capacitors swell and burst.
 

Our pool maintenance in Tomball, TX, approach is proactive. We look for the small leaks before they become big floods.

  • We check the pump lid O-ring. If it’s cracking, we lube it or replace it.

  • We listen to the motor. If the bearings are starting to whine, we let you know.

  • We check the filter pressure gauge. It tells us the health of the system.

  • We monitor the water level. If it’s too low, the pump sucks air. If it’s too high, the skimmer doesn't work.

We keep the system running efficiently so you don't burn out a $1,500 motor because of a $10 maintenance issue.

Green Pool Cleanup in Tomball, TX

Sometimes, life happens. You went on vacation. The timer tripped. The dog knocked the chlorinator over. Now the pool is green.

It’s not just ugly. It’s a breeding ground for mosquitoes and bacteria.
 

Green pool cleanup in Tomball, TX requires a heavy hand. You cannot just pour a jug of bleach in and wait.

  1. Assessment: We test the water to see why it turned. Is the stabilizer too high? Is the filter torn?

  2. Treatment: We use industrial-strength algaecides and shock to kill the bloom.

  3. Flocculation: If the pool is a swamp, we add a flocculant to bind the particles and drop them to the floor.

  4. Vacuum to Waste: We slowly vacuum the dead algae out of the pool, bypassing the filter so it doesn't clog the system.

  5. Filter Clean: We chemically clean the grids or cartridges to remove the spores.

We turn swamps back into swimming pools.

Pool Equipment & Pump Repair in Tomball TX

​

When the equipment fails, the clock starts ticking. In the summer, you have about 24 to 48 hours before the water turns.

​

We offer fast pool pump repair in Tomball, TX. We troubleshoot the real issue.

  • Pumps: If the motor hums but won't start, it might just be a capacitor. We fix that. If the shaft seal is leaking, we replace it.

  • Filters: We replace torn grids in DE filters and worn-out cartridges. We fix leaking band clamps and broken air relief valves.

  • Timers and Controls: We replace broken Intermatic timers and troubleshoot complex automation systems that have lost connection.

  • Valves: We rebuild Jandy valves that are stiff or leaking.

  • Salt Cells: We clean calcium buildup off the plates and replace dead cells.

We don't try to sell you a new system if we can fix the one you have. We treat your money like it’s our own.
